Born in New York City and raised in Dallas, Shlesinger attended the Greenhill School, a private institution, in Addison, Texas. She studied languages but also got involved in improvisation, and went on to perform with ComedySportz Dallas. She studied at Boston's Emerson College, majoring in film. She also refined her skills as an editor and writer. Her education has come in handy, as she has written a number of specials, as well as hosting or starring in television series and films.
In 2008, Shlesinger won “Last Comic Standing,” while “Warpaint,” a comedy special that marked her debut, was one of iTunes' most-downloaded programs. That success brought her to the notice of Netflix, which picked up “Freezing Hot,” her next special.
Shlesinger specializes in taking aim at the myths that abound about women, and gender relations in general. She also explains how she can tame the “party goblin” that appears when she has too much to drink.
